【必見】GTM4WP – A Google Tag Manager (GTM) plugin for WordPressで実現する高度なタグ管理術
—
GTM4WPとは何か?基本概要とメリット
Google Tag Manager(GTM)とは?
Google Tag Manager(GTM)は、ウェブサイトやモバイルアプリに設置するタグ(解析ツールや広告タグなどのコード断片)を一元管理できる無料のタグ管理システムです。GTMを利用することで、ウェブサイトのソースコードを直接編集せずにタグの追加・修正・削除が可能となり、マーケティング担当者や分析担当者がスムーズに運用できます。これにより、Webサイトのパフォーマンスを損なうことなく、多様なタグを迅速に管理できるのが大きなメリットです。
GTMは、タグの発火条件やトリガー、変数の設定など柔軟な管理ができるため、効率的かつ高度な解析環境を構築できます。WordPressのようなCMSにおいても、GTMを活用することでSEOや広告効果測定、ユーザー行動分析の精度向上が期待できます。
GTM4WPプラグインの特徴と役割
GTM4WP(正式名称:A Google Tag Manager (GTM) plugin for WordPress)は、WordPressサイトにGoogle Tag Managerを簡単に導入し、高度なタグ管理を実現するためのプラグインです。通常、GTMをWordPressに導入するにはテーマのheader.phpなどにコードを埋め込む必要がありますが、GTM4WPを使うことでプログラミング知識なしでスムーズに設定可能です。
さらに、GTM4WPは標準で以下のような特徴を持ちます。
– データレイヤーの自動生成とカスタマイズが可能
– 電子商取引(EC)トラッキングに対応し、WooCommerceなどのECプラグインと連携
– フォーム送信やリンククリックなどのユーザー行動をトラッキング可能
– カスタムイベントの設定やユーザー属性の送信も支援
これらの機能により、WordPressサイトの解析や広告効果測定の高度化を容易に実現できるのです。
WordPressサイトにGTM4WPを導入するメリット
GTM4WPの導入によって得られるメリットは複数あります。まず、タグ管理が一元化され、サイトの改修やタグの更新が楽になる点が大きいです。マーケティング担当者が自らGTMの管理画面でタグを追加・修正できるため、開発依頼の手間やタイムラグを削減できます。
また、GTM4WPはデータレイヤーの自動生成により、分析に必要なユーザー属性やページ情報を簡単にGoogle Analyticsなどに渡せます。特にECサイトでは、購入履歴や商品情報を正確にトラッキングできるため、売上分析や広告最適化に役立ちます。
さらに、カスタムイベントやフォーム送信の計測設定も容易なので、ユーザー行動の詳細な把握が可能です。これにより、サイト改善のためのデータ活用が飛躍的に向上します。
他のタグ管理方法との比較
従来のタグ管理は、各種解析ツールのコードを直接テーマファイルに埋め込む方法が主流でしたが、この方法は以下のような課題がありました。
– タグの追加や修正のたびに開発者の作業が必要
– コードのミスによるサイト表示への影響リスク
– タグの管理が分散し、管理工数増加
これに対し、GTMを使う方法はタグの一元管理と即時反映を実現しますが、WordPress単体での実装はやや敷居が高いのが難点です。そこでGTM4WPが登場することで、WordPress特有の機能やデータ構造に対応した専用の橋渡しを提供し、初心者でも安心して活用できる環境を整えています。
—
GTM4WPのインストールと初期設定方法
プラグインのダウンロードとインストール手順
GTM4WPプラグインはWordPress公式プラグインディレクトリに公開されており、管理画面から簡単にインストールできます。手順は以下の通りです。
1. WordPress管理画面の「プラグイン」>「新規追加」をクリック
2. 検索窓に「GTM4WP」または「Google Tag Manager」と入力
3. 「GTM4WP – A Google Tag Manager (GTM) plugin for WordPress」を選択し、「今すぐインストール」ボタンを押す
4. インストール完了後、「有効化」をクリック
また、下記リンクから直接ダウンロードも可能です。
GTMアカウントとコンテナの作成方法
GTMを利用するには、GoogleアカウントでGTMのアカウント作成とコンテナ設定が必要です。手順は以下です。
1. [Google Tag Manager公式サイト](https://tagmanager.google.com/)にアクセスし、Googleアカウントでログイン
2. 「アカウントを作成」からアカウント名(企業名やサイト名)を入力
3. コンテナ名にWordPressサイトのURLを入力し、「ウェブ」を選択
4. 「作成」を押して利用規約に同意
5. 提示されるGTMコードは、GTM4WPで設定するためメモしておく(コンテナIDは「GTM-XXXXXX」の形式)
作成したコンテナIDをGTM4WPの設定画面に入力することで、WordPressサイトにタグ管理環境が構築されます。
GTM4WPプラグインの基本設定画面の解説
プラグインの有効化後、WordPress管理画面の「設定」>「Google Tag Manager」から基本設定が可能です。主な設定項目は以下の通りです。
– **GTMコンテナID**:先ほど取得した「GTM-XXXXXX」を入力
– **データレイヤー変数の有効化**:ユーザーデータやカスタムイベントを送る場合は有効化推奨
– **ECトラッキングの有効化**:WooCommerceなどのECサイト運営者向けに推奨
– **ユーザー属性の送信**:ログインユーザーIDやユーザー役割を送信するか選択可能
– **トラッキングスクリプトの挿入位置**:通常はヘッダー推奨だが、テーマによってはフッターに変更可能
これらの設定を保存すれば、基本的なGTMのタグ管理がWordPressに組み込まれます。
トラッキングIDの登録と確認方法
設定完了後は、Google Tag Managerの管理画面でタグの作成とトリガー設定を行い、タグが正しく発火しているか確認します。確認には以下の方法が使えます。
– **プレビュー機能**:GTM管理画面の「プレビュー」を有効化し、対象サイトを開くとタグの発火状況がリアルタイムで表示される
– **Google Chromeのタグアシスタント(Tag Assistant)拡張機能**:サイト上のタグの動作を検証できる
– **Google Analyticsリアルタイムレポート**:タグが正しく送信されているか確認
これらを活用しながら、設定したトラッキングIDとタグが正常に反映されているかを必ず確認してください。
—
GTM4WPのプラグイン基本情報
| 項目 | 内容 |
|---|---|
| プラグイン名 | GTM4WP – A Google Tag Manager (GTM) plugin for WordPress |
| 説明 | Advanced tag management for WordPress with Google Tag Manager |
| 有効インストール数 | 不明(公式ページ参照) |
| 平均評価 | 0.0 / 5 |
| 公式ページ | WordPressプラグイン公式 |
—
GTM4WPで実現できる主なタグ管理機能
標準で対応しているタグの種類
GTM4WPは、Google Analytics(ユニバーサルアナリティクスおよびGA4)をはじめ、以下のタグ種別に対応しています。
– ページビューの自動計測
– カスタムイベントトラッキング
– 電子商取引(EC)トラッキング(購入やカート操作)
– フォーム送信のトラッキング
– リンククリックのトラッキング
– ユーザー属性やログイン情報の送信
これにより、基本的な解析ニーズをカバーできるだけでなく、サイトの特性に合わせた柔軟なタグ管理が可能です。
カスタムイベントトラッキングの設定方法
WordPressサイトで特定のユーザー行動を計測したい場合、カスタムイベントをGTM4WPを通して簡単に設定できます。例えば、特定のボタンをクリックした際にイベントを発火させるには、以下の手順が一般的です。
1. GTM4WPの設定画面でカスタムイベントの送信を有効にする
2. WordPressのテーマやプラグインでクリックイベントに対応したJavaScriptを埋め込む(必要に応じて)
3. GTMの管理画面で新規タグを作成し、イベントカテゴリやアクション、ラベルを設定
4. 対応するトリガー(例:クリック)を設定し公開
このように、GTM4WPがデータレイヤーにイベント情報を自動または手動でプッシュすることで、GTM側でタグ管理が容易になります。
電子商取引(EC)トラッキングの実装例
WooCommerceなどのECプラグインを利用している場合、GTM4WPはECトラッキングに対応しています。商品購入やカート追加、決済完了などのイベントを自動でデータレイヤーに送信し、Google Analyticsなどで詳細な売上分析が可能です。
具体的には以下のようなデータが送信されます。
– 商品ID、名称、カテゴリ、単価、数量
– トランザクションID、購入合計額、税金、送料
– カートへの追加・削除イベント
これにより、広告効果測定やコンバージョン分析が精緻化し、マーケティング施策の改善に直結します。
フォーム送信やリンククリックの計測設定
GTM4WPはフォーム送信やリンククリックのトラッキングもサポートしています。例えば、お問い合わせフォームの送信完了を計測したい場合は、フォームの送信ボタンに特定のクラス名やIDを付与し、GTMのトリガー設定で該当要素のクリックや送信を検知させます。
同様に外部リンククリックや電話番号タップの計測も可能で、ユーザーの行動パターンやコンバージョン経路の分析に役立ちます。
—
GTM4WPの高度な使い方と応用テクニック
ユーザー属性やカスタム変数の活用方法
GTM4WPでは、WordPressのログインユーザー情報やカスタムユーザーメタデータをデータレイヤーに追加できます。これにより、ユーザーセグメント別の解析が可能になります。例えば、登録ユーザーの役割(管理者、購読者など)をイベントに含めることで、特定ユーザーグループの行動を分析しやすくなります。
カスタム変数も同様にGTM4WPの設定で追加でき、サイト独自の属性や状態をタグに連携可能です。
データレイヤーの理解とカスタマイズ
GTM4WPの核となるのは「データレイヤー」の出力です。データレイヤーはJavaScriptのオブジェクトで、GTMに対してユーザー情報やイベント情報を提供します。GTM4WPはこのデータレイヤーを自動生成しつつ、テーマやプラグインのフックを使ってカスタマイズが可能です。
高度なカスタマイズ例として、特定のカスタム投稿タイプの閲覧情報やユーザーの購入フロー段階をデータレイヤーに追加し、GTM側で細かくタグを制御できます。
複数コンテナの管理と切り替え方法
大規模サイトやマルチサイト環境では、複数のGTMコンテナを使い分けたい場合があります。GTM4WPは複数コンテナIDの設定や、特定ページ・投稿での切り替えも可能です。これにより、部門別やサイト別にタグ運用を分離しつつ、一括管理も実現できます。
トラブルシューティングとよくあるエラーの対処法
GTM4WP導入時によくある問題としては、タグが発火しない、データレイヤーが正しく送信されない、競合プラグインとの相性問題などがあります。対処法は以下の通りです。
– GTMのプレビュー機能でタグの発火状況を確認
– キャッシュ系プラグインを一時停止し影響を確認
– テーマのカスタマイズによりheader.phpやfooter.phpのコードが干渉していないか検証
– コンソールエラーの有無をブラウザの開発者ツールでチェック
これらの手順で問題点を特定し、公式ドキュメントやコミュニティで情報収集するのが効果的です。
—
WordPress初心者でも安心!わかりやすい設定のコツ
設定ミスを防ぐポイント
設定時には以下のポイントに注意しましょう。
– GTMコンテナIDの入力ミスを避ける
– テーマやキャッシュプラグインとの相性を確認し、不要なキャッシュはクリアする
– 設定変更後は必ずGTMのプレビューで動作確認を行う
– 不要なタグや重複タグの有無をチェックしてパフォーマンス低下を防ぐ
これらは初心者がつまずきやすいポイントですが、慎重に作業すれば問題は回避できます。
プラグインのアップデート時に気をつけること
GTM4WPは定期的にアップデートが行われており、新機能の追加やバグ修正があります。アップデート前に必ずバックアップを取り、動作に影響がないかテスト環境で確認することをおすすめします。
また、WordPress本体や他のプラグインとの互換性にも注意し、アップデート後はタグの発火やデータ送信に問題がないかチェックしましょう。
セキュリティ面での注意点
GTM4WP自体は安全性の高いプラグインですが、GTMで管理するタグに悪意のあるコードが混入しないよう、信頼できるタグのみを設置することが重要です。加えて、管理画面のアクセス権限を適切に設定し、タグ管理者以外の不要な操作を制限しましょう。
効率的な運用のためのおすすめプラクティス
– タグ設計は事前にしっかり計画し、無駄なタグを増やさない
– タグ名やイベント名は分かりやすく命名し、管理しやすくする
– 定期的にタグの見直しを行い、古いタグは削除する
– チーム内でGTMの運用ルールを共有し、トラブルを防ぐ
これらを実践することで、長期的に安定したタグ管理環境を維持できます。
—
GTM4WP導入後の効果検証と改善方法
Googleアナリティクスとの連携方法
GTM4WPを経由してGoogle Analytics(GA)と連携することで、より詳細なユーザー行動データを取得できます。GAのタグはGTM側で管理し、GTM4WPはWordPressから必要な変数をデータレイヤーに渡す役割を担います。
GA4の導入が進む中、GTM4WPはGA4イベントトラッキングにも対応しており、ECサイトの売上データ送信など最新の解析ニーズにも応えられます。
タグ発火の確認とデバッグツールの使い方
タグが正しく機能しているかどうかは、GTMの「プレビュー」モードやGoogle Chromeの「タグアシスタント(Tag Assistant)」拡張機能で簡単に確認可能です。これらのツールを使うことで、どのタグがどのタイミングで発火しているのか詳細に把握でき、不具合の早期発見につながります。
効果測定から見える改善ポイント
取得したデータをもとにユーザーの離脱ポイントやコンバージョン率の低いページを分析し、サイト改善の施策を検討します。タグ管理が適切に行われていれば、こうした分析がスムーズに進み、PDCAサイクルの高速化が期待できます。
定期的なメンテナンスの必要性
導入後もWordPressのアップデートやプラグインの更新、サイト構造の変更に伴いタグ管理の見直しが必要です。定期的に設定状況をチェックし、不要なタグの削除や新たなトラッキングの追加を行うことで、常に最適な解析環境を保てます。
—
まとめ:GTM4WPで叶えるWordPressの高度タグ管理
本記事のポイント総括
本記事では、WordPressにおけるGoogle Tag Managerの導入を劇的に簡単かつ高度にするプラグイン「GTM4WP」の特徴、導入手順から応用設定までを詳しく解説しました。GTM4WPは初心者でも扱いやすい設計ながら、ECトラッキングやカスタムイベントなど多彩な機能を備え、サイト解析の質を大幅に向上させます。
今後の活用アイデアと拡張性
今後はGA4の普及に伴い、GTM4WPのGA4対応機能を活かしてより詳細なユーザートラッキングを進めることがトレンドです。また、カスタムデータレイヤーの活用や複数コンテナの管理によって、大規模サイトや多様なマーケティングチャネルを持つサイトでも柔軟な運用が可能です。
参考になる公式ドキュメントとコミュニティ情報
公式ドキュメントやGitHubリポジトリ、WordPressフォーラムなどには最新の情報やトラブルシューティングが豊富にあります。積極的に活用し、疑問点はコミュニティで質問することでスムーズな導入・運用が可能です。
—
GTM4WPは、WordPressサイトに高度なタグ管理を導入したいすべてのユーザーにとって強力なツールです。ぜひ導入を検討し、解析・マーケティングの精度向上に役立ててください。


コメント